CMP0198ΒΆ
Added in version 4.2.
CMAKE_PARENT_LIST_FILE
is not defined in CMakeLists.txt
.
CMake 4.1 and below defined CMAKE_PARENT_LIST_FILE
when processing
a CMakeLists.txt
even though there is no parent file. CMake 4.2
and above prefer to not define CMAKE_PARENT_LIST_FILE
. This policy
provides compatibility for projects that accidentally relied on the
old behavior.
The OLD
behavior for this policy is to set
CMAKE_PARENT_LIST_FILE
to CMAKE_CURRENT_LIST_FILE
when processing a CMakeLists.txt
. The NEW
behavior for this policy
is to not set CMAKE_PARENT_LIST_FILE
.
This policy was introduced in CMake version 4.2.
It may be set by cmake_policy()
or cmake_minimum_required()
.
If it is not set, CMake does not warn, and uses OLD
behavior.
Note
The OLD
behavior of a policy is
deprecated by definition
and may be removed in a future version of CMake.
